什么是消息认证
发布网友
发布时间:2024-10-23 22:48
我来回答
共1个回答
热心网友
时间:11小时前
消息认证是一种安全机制,主要用于验证消息的来源是否真实、消息内容是否被篡改、以及消息的传输过程是否安全。
消息认证在通信和网络安全领域具有重要意义。以下是关于消息认证的详细解释:
一、消息认证的基本定义
消息认证主要验证消息的完整性和真实性。在网络通信过程中,当发送方发送消息时,会通过一定的技术手段对消息进行加密、签名等操作,以确保接收方能够确认消息的真实来源,并检测消息在传输过程中是否被篡改。
二、消息认证的重要性
1. 防止消息篡改:通过消息认证,可以确保消息在传输过程中没有被第三方修改或替换,保持消息的完整性。
2. 确认消息来源:消息认证可以验证消息的发送方是否真实,防止假冒身份或欺诈行为。
3. 提高通信安全性:消息认证能够确保通信双方之间的安全通信,降低被攻击的风险。
三、消息认证的技术手段
消息认证通常包括加密技术、数字签名、哈希函数等技术手段。其中,加密技术可以对消息进行加密处理,确保只有接收方能够解密并获取原始消息;数字签名则用于验证消息的来源,确保消息由合法发送方发送;哈希函数则用于检测消息是否被篡改。
四、应用场景
消息认证在各个领域都有广泛应用,如金融交易、社交媒体、电子邮件等。通过消息认证,可以确保交易信息的安全、防止社交工程攻击,以及保护电子邮件通信的安全。
总之,消息认证是一种确保网络通信安全的重要机制,通过验证消息的来源、内容和传输过程,保护消息的完整性和真实性。